#e8fff2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8fff2 is composed of 91% red, 100%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 146.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 95.5%. #e8fff2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d1ffe5. Closest websafe color is: #ffffff.

#e8fff2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e8fff2 has RGB values of R:232, G:255,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0. Its decimal value is 15269874.
